Characteristics of the Collie with Labrabull

The Collie with Labrabull is a medium to large-sized dog, with a muscular build and a robust frame. They typically inherit the stunning coat of the Collie, which can come in a variety of colors, including sable, tricolor, blue merle, and white. Their eyes are expressive and often display a warm and friendly demeanor.

In terms of temperament, the Collie with Labrabull is known for being intelligent, loyal, and protective. They are excellent family pets and do well with children and other animals. However, they may exhibit herding instincts from the Collie parent, so early socialization and training are essential to prevent any unwanted behavior.

Care Requirements of the Collie with Labrabull

When it comes to caring for a Collie with Labrabull, regular exercise is essential. These dogs are energetic and require daily walks, playtime, and mental stimulation to keep them happy and healthy. They also thrive on human interaction and may become destructive if left alone for extended periods.

Grooming is another important aspect of caring for a Collie with Labrabull. Their thick double coat requires regular brushing to prevent matting and reduce shedding. Additionally, regular bathing and nail trimming are essential to keep them clean and comfortable.
